    Symvanta provides your AI coding agent with an accurate real call graph of your codebase through MCP, eliminating guesswork and allowing it to understand potential issues before making changes. By indexing your repositories into a dynamic code graph, Symvanta captures precise symbols, callers, dependencies, and the potential impact of changes across every repository within your project. This graph is made accessible through MCP tools that any AI coding agent can utilize, including Cursor, Claude Code, Codex, and others. With Symvanta, you benefit from a unified graph that encompasses all your repositories, rather than having to analyze them individually. This comprehensive approach enhances efficiency and helps maintain code integrity during the development process.
